CAPT. SHAWN D. MARTINEZ

CAPT. SHAWN D. MARTINEZ is a 2012 towing vessel. The Coast Guard has recorded 16 inspections since 2012, most recently in February 2025, along with 2 casualty investigations between 2014 and 2020.
